Contents are France on the Eve of the Revolution; The Victory of the Aristocracy; The Victory of the Third Estate; The Failure to Compromise; The Reshaping of France 1789-1791; The Turning Point; The Division of the Republican; The Precarious Victory of the Sans-Culottes; The Failure of Both Principle and Expediency; The Aftermath.
